要从Firebase数据库中获取键值为电子邮件的特定数据,你可以按照以下步骤进行操作:
var database = firebase.database();
orderByChild()
方法和equalTo()
方法,结合你要查询的键和值,来获取特定数据。例如,以下代码将获取键名为"email",值为你想要的特定电子邮件的数据:var emailRef = database.ref('your-database-path').orderByChild('email').equalTo('specific-email@example.com');
在上面的代码中,将your-database-path
替换为你实际的数据库路径。
on()
方法或once()
方法来监听数据的变化或只获取一次数据。例如,以下代码使用once()
方法获取数据并处理结果:emailRef.once('value').then(function(snapshot) {
// 处理数据
var data = snapshot.val();
// 对获取的数据进行操作
});
在上面的代码中,snapshot.val()
将返回查询结果的数据。
通过以上步骤,你就可以从Firebase数据库中获取键值为电子邮件的特定数据了。
此外,Firebase还有其他强大的功能和产品,如实时数据库、云存储、身份验证、云函数等。你可以根据具体需求选择使用。更多关于Firebase数据库的详细信息,请参考腾讯云Firebase产品介绍页面:https://cloud.tencent.com/product/firebase
领取专属 10元无门槛券
手把手带您无忧上云